BLUE
COAST ARTISTS ANNOUNCE
21st ANNUAL STUDIO TOUR OCTOBER 2nd & 3rd
For over twenty years the Blue Coast Artists have been
delighting and educating the public with their annual Fall Tour of
Studios. Viewers are invited once again to experience the creative process
in action on Sat. & Sun. Oct. 2nd and
3rd. See a piece of pottery form, watch glass beads take shape in
the torch, a tree come alive through brushstrokes or a bird emerge from a
piece of wood. These are just a few of the demonstrations that art lovers
of all ages are sure to enjoy during the 21st Annual Blue Coast Artists
Fall Tour of Studios. This annual West Michigan autumn event runs from
10AM-6PM both days and is free of charge. The Blue Coast Artists Fall Tour began in 1989 when
glassblowers Jerry & Kathy Catania, weaver and furniture maker Barb
& Al Bare and potter Mark Williams held their open houses on the same
weekend. Over the past twenty
years the group has included many artists working in many media and their
Fall Tour continues to be an educational and interesting experience for
all. The 2010 tour includes seven working artists' studios located between South Haven and Saugatuck. Each site features demonstrations, original artwork, refreshments and more. Hands-on art making projects, unique art abodes, a haunted garden and fall color makes this creative experience fun for the whole family.
